Burning Test Machine

  • Burning Test Machine – scraping needle and scraper: A, scraping needle (QC / T730 standard): diameter 0.45mm, the material complies with GB / T4358 requirements B, scraper (ISO6722, JB / T8139, JASO D611, DIN72551, VW60306) Scraper diameter: 0.125mm
  • scraping head stroke: 10 ~ 20mm adjustable
  • scratch length: 15.5mm
  • scraping speed: 10 ~ 60 times / minute adjustable Scraping weight: 300g, 400g, 500g, 600g, 700g, 750g, 800g, 900g, 1100g each one.

Compliance – Freedom of Association

  • incorrect number of welfare officers (see factory regulations for Bangladesh)
  • factory has no welfare officer and factory does not have written procedure as to how workers can express themselves e.g. suggestion box
  • no strong in house welfare team
  • no Worker’s welfare committee formed and no satisfactory workers representation
  • factory does not help workers select their representatives from themselves.
  • welfare committee does not meet every 2 months or once a month (depending on local law)
  • meeting discussions and outcome are not recorded accurately
  • workers are not aware of welfare committee, the meetings and their outcome
  • factory does not have policy about freedom of association & right to collective bargaining
  • factory does not have trade union or selected worker’s representative
  • factory has not established a worker’s participation committee and formation has not been documented
  • role of workers participation committee is not clearly defined
  • written grievance handling procedure is not available and workers are not aware of their rights
